			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="font-weight:bold;font-size:14px;">Gartner Identifies the Top 10 Strategic Technologies for 2008</span></p>
<p>Among others Gartner <a href="http://www.gartner.com/it/page.jsp?id=530109" target="_blank">describes</a> i find interesting these two :</p>
<p><strong><span>Real World Web.</span></strong> <span> The term “real world Web” is informal, referring to places where information from the Web is applied to the particular location, activity or context in the real world. It is intended to augment the reality that a user faces, not to replace it as in virtual worlds. It is used in real-time based on the real world situation, not prepared in advance for consumption at specific times or researched after the events have occurred. For example in navigation, a printed list of directions from the Web do not react to changes, but a GPS navigation unit provides real-time directions that react to events and movements; the latter case is akin to the real-world Web of augmented reality. Now is the time to seek out new applications, new revenue streams and improvements to business process that can come from augmenting the world at the right time, place or situation.</span></p>
<p><strong><span>Social Software.</span></strong><span>  Through 2010, the enterprise Web 2.0 product environment will experience considerable flux with continued product innovation and new entrants, including start-ups, large vendors and traditional collaboration vendors. Expect significant consolidation as competitors strive to deliver robust Web 2.0 offerings to the enterprise. Nevertheless social software technologies will increasingly be brought into the enterprise to augment traditional collaboration.</span></p>
<p><span>Augmented reality is probably the real revoulution in the next few years. Amplifing our sense and introduce real time data in our perception, based on our location. It&#8217;s already happening with some experimental tourist guides and  geo tagging.</span></p>
<p>Think you have a device (mobile phone with gps for example) and you receive information related to the place you are or related to your friend&#8217;s position. It&#8217;a already happening. Call it <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Location-based_service">LBS</a> (location based services) .</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Facebook has announced its much hyped advertising strategy. As reported by <a href="http://www.readwriteweb.com/archives/facebook_unveils_ad_strategy.php" target="_blank">readwriteweb:</a></p>
<p>Facebook&#8217;s ad strategy has three main components: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Business pages</strong> &#8211; Businesses can build profile pages on Facebook that users can interact with. I&#8217;m not sure what the benefit is here over the Facebook sponsored groups that businesses have been paying large fees to have for months. 100,000 business pages supposedly launched today, though.</li>
<li><strong>Social Ads</strong> and <strong>Beacon</strong> &#8211; Ads targeted by user profile data &#8212; everything from favorite music to relationship status, and the ability for people to publish product interactions from third-party sites to their news feed .</li>
<li><strong>Insight</strong> &#8211; Marketing and usage metrics for advertisers about who is clicking on their ads and how to better target them.</li>
</ul>
<p>Missed the occasion to create the new AdSense and what about the use of personal information to target ad? (well, google is already doing it ?). Nothing new in business model. What about giving back someyhing back to content generators? (I.E. users).</p>
<p>Social advertising? What is it exactly? Just advertising on user generated content? or there is something more?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>         Google is announcing a way for programmers to build social applications for multiple Web sites at once.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s a set of common application programming interfaces (APIs) that will enable developers to create applications for social networks, blogs and any Web sites that accept the OpenSocial code. Currently, developers have to write new programs for each site, even if the functionality will be the same on each site.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In an apparent about-face, Apple Inc. will allow third-party applications to work directly on the iPhone, Chief Executive Steve Jobs said in a posting on the company&#8217;s Web site Wednesday.</p>
<p>A software development kit will let coders create applications to work directly on the iPhone.</p>
<p>Apple infuriated developers and some iPhone users when it issued a software update September 27 that disabled unofficial programs installed on the handsets.</p>
<p>Until Wednesday, Apple had tried to control which applications consumers had on their iPhones.</p>
<p>Now, Jobs said the company intends to release a software development kit in February that will let coders create applications to work directly on the iPhone and the iPod Touch. The Touch is the new iPod portable player that resembles the iPhone but lacks the function of a cell phone.</p>
<p>&#8220;We are excited about creating a vibrant third-party developer community around the iPhone and enabling hundreds of new applications for our users,&#8221; Jobs said in the posting.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It&#8217;s a few minutes that a breaking news is spreading over the internet.</p>
<p>A 13-year-old hacker claims to have developed code that would let you put third-party applications on an iPod Touch without having to take a computer science class.</p>
<p>AriX ha developed iJailbreak, an automated program that allows third-party applications to run on the <a href="http://reviews.cnet.com/portable-video-players-pvps/apple-ipod-touch-16gb/4505-6499_7-32595956.html" class="external-link">iPod Touch</a>.</p>
<p>Ever since Apple <a href="http://www.news.com/8301-13579_3-9786644-37.html" title="Owners of unlocked iPhones hosed by software update -- Thursday, Sep 27, 2007">released the 1.1.1 software update</a> for both the iPhone and the iPod Touch in late September that broke older third-party application installers, hackers have been <a href="http://www.news.com/8301-13579_3-9793185-37.html" title="This day's Apple: Lawsuits, 'jailbreaks' and Nanos -- Monday, Oct 8, 2007">hard at work</a> searching for a new way to bypass the restrictions. A <a href="http://www.news.com/8301-13579_3-9795769-37.html" title="The Great iPhone Hack, round 3 -- Thursday, Oct 11, 2007">preliminary jailbreaking application</a> was released last week, but it required a great deal of expertise to get up and running. Erica Sadun, a writer for The Unofficial Apple Weblog, <a href="http://www.tuaw.com/2007/10/12/tuaw-touch-jailbreak-liveblog/" class="external-link">installed that iPod Touch jailbreak</a> Friday evening but warned, &#8220;This is not ready for prime time, kids. Don&#8217;t do this at home.&#8221;</p>
<p>Apple gives the possibility to install web apps developed for the iPhone and the iPod Touch according to guidelines and specific user interface.
